More distro-hopping

eOS, despite having a nice interface, started to annoy me. Little things that I take for granted, like not seeing the progress of a downloading file (which admittedly might just be a midori thing and not eOS generally), not being able to plug in my scanner and have it work (even though it was detected and correctly identified by simplescan!) and not being able to pin custom app icons to the dock or app menu - even though I was getting my hands dirty making .desktop files in the command line and everything! The music player was doing my head in as well. Duplicate songs might have come from my rsync experiments, but they were a ball-ache to clear up. And I couldn't install Steam via the package manager either, I had to use the same debian script I used for #!. There was some other stuff as well, to do with the file manager. It was death by a thousand cuts really. I'm sure eOS will be really good in a couple of years, but for the time-being I think I need something more fully-...

None of this is particularly complicated, so I'll keep it brief: - changed camille to user group mitch:  useradd -G {group-name} username I think this is the command I used... - added piNAS to the file manager by adding the following to .gtk-bookmarks:  sftp://192.168.1.107/media/Seagate%20Expansion%20Drive Raspberry Pi - downloaded soulseek (I need to create a .desktop executable file to add this to application menu) - something else... what was it? I remember copypasting long statements into the command line... yikes [edit] ah yeah, it was sudo apt-add-repository ppa:versable/elementary-update to add the community repository, and then some themes and stuff.
